Join our team as a Graduate Consultant and benefit from early responsibility on project work that will broaden and strengthen your technical and commercial skills. We specialise in delivering complex, technology‑based projects, largely into the UK Public Sector. Our customers include the Home Office, the Ministry of Defence, the Department of Transport, the Ministry of Justice, Police Forces, the Department for Education, as well as a range of private sector organisations that operate in regulated markets.

Our work covers a broad range of topics including architecture development, cyber security, programme and project management through to data engineering/analytics and AI. We have a long track record of successful delivery and, as a result, are trusted to work on some of the UK Government’s most important and sensitive projects. The range of clients and project work we offer ensures that you will gain exposure to a wide variety of technical and business challenges in a short space of time.

Working Arrangements

Hybrid working model, with an office base in Guildford, Surrey and access to our other offices in London, Swindon and Cheltenham. Typical working week might involve 2-3 days working at clients’ premises or other locations and the remainder at home or at one of our offices. Some projects may require up to 5 days per week on‑site with colleagues. The practicalities of some project work means that individuals may need to stay away from home during the working week. Team‑based project environment with opportunities to participate in internal initiatives.

A Mentor will be on hand to provide support and guidance throughout your journey with Actica. You will also work with a Performance and Development Manager, often outside of your project line of control, who will conduct regular reviews based on project feedback to set career objectives and identify training courses which are both relevant to your current project work, and aligned with your planned career progression.

How to prepare for a job interview at Actica Consulting

✨Know Your Tech

As a Graduate Consultant, you'll be dealing with technology-based projects. Brush up on the latest trends in cyber security, AI, and data analytics. Be ready to discuss how these technologies can impact the public sector and share your thoughts on their applications.

✨Showcase Problem-Solving Skills

Actica Consulting values excellent problem-solving abilities. Prepare examples from your academic or personal experiences where you tackled complex issues.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ses and highlight your analytical thinking.

✨Engage with Stakeholders

Demonstrate your ability to communicate effectively with stakeholders. Think of instances where you've had to present ideas or collaborate with others. Be prepared to discuss how you would approach building relationships with clients and team members in a consultancy setting.

✨Adaptability is Key

The fast-paced nature of consulting requires quick thinking and adaptability. Share experiences where you've had to adjust to new challenges or environments. Highlight your willingness to learn and take on unfamiliar subjects,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.
